Blockchain is a kind of tamper resistant digital ledger. The ledger stores data in groupings called "blocks." What data gets stored in the blocks depends on what the blockchain is being used for (whether it's to transfer digital currency, or to store and distribute other transaction information like real estate or medical records, and so on). Also stored in the blocks is an encrypted digital fingerprint, or hash, that identifies the block and what data is inside it. Each newly generated block also contains the previously generated block's digital fingerprint such that the blocks can be sequentially linked or "chained" together, hence the term "blockchain." Tampering with the data inside any block within the chain is therefore difficult, in part because such tampering would constitute an alteration of the block's digital fingerprint, thereby risking the unlinking of the block and the breaking of the chain.
